Técnico de Laboratorio de CAlidad

QUALITY LABORATORY TECHNICIAN

Role Summary
Verification of parts according to the control guideline and its characteristics.

Key Responsibilities
• Verification of parts according to the control guideline and its characteristics.
• Correctly use personal protective equipment for each activity you perform.
• Necessary adjustments and verification of parameters for machine productivity along with good part quality.
• Know and use SAP to create notifications for different maintenance.
• TPM Auto maintenance and installation check list.
• Carry out machine preparations with documentation and supplies at the machine.
• Correctly operate the E-Coat system with TTX equipment
• Check the raw material that enters the line, checking for possible bumps or dirt, marks, rust or defects that affect the painting process.
• Check the proper placement of the raw material racks on the line using the forklift drivers.
• In addition, you must assume responsibility for the production assigned to the line and the care of the measuring instruments on the line.
• Daily measurement of phosphate deposit and crystal size.
• Take care of resources in the process and avoid waste to be competitive in cost.
• Self-control of one's own emotions and conflict and stress reactions.
• Be able to efficiently communicate your concerns to the process.
• Carry out chemical control of all stages of the process according to document R-260-PR/R-251-PR
• Be aware of the line to avoid stoppages that affect the quality of the parts in process. Keep statistical process control charts updated.

Education
Bachelor or technical on chemical area.

Work Experience
• Experience in automotive industry preferably

Additional information
•Manejo PC (deseable)
•Manejo herramienta manual
•Procesos de Fosfato y pintura E-Coat. 
•Química básica• SAP
